The maximum shift of the IRTS is 0.57 min. This means the end of peak-based
area is at 2.80 min and the next time-based cut with reference to IRTS can be
placed at 2.8 + 0.57 = 3.37 min.
Here is an example of how fluctuations that occur during a run can be
compensated with the help of the IRTS and dynamic cut shifting.
The chromatograms below shows the results obtained from MassHunter Qual.
The top 1D chromatogram shows the original reference chromatogram the
method was based on. The middle 1D chromatogram indicates the RT shift.
The cut-markers image below show that time-based cuts were dynamically
shifted accordingly.

NOTE
If a time-based cut shifts to the front and would enter the peak-based area
(bracket) the dynamic cut shift will not work.
